Ranieri demands big reaction

Published on: 07 January 2019

Claudio Ranieri slammed his Fulham players for a lack of passion as they slumped to an embarrassing FA Cup defeat to Oldham Athletic.

The League Two side won the third-round clash at Craven Cottage 2-1, a result that left Ranieri disappointed and frustrated.

"I wanted more from my players," the Italian said afterwards.

"If you lose but you give 100 per cent of your personality, desire, everything, passion, I can accept that Oldham scored twice. But we didn't play with passion, that's the problem."

After Denis Odoi had given Fulham the lead, Sam Surridge equalised for the Latics with 14 minutes remaining.

Daniel Iversen then saved a penalty from Fulham substitute Aleksandar Mitrovic before Callum Lang headed an 88th-minute winner for the visitors.
